About This Rental in Molenschot

Modern Senior-Friendly Apartment for Rent in the Green Village of Molenschot

This newly built apartment is part of the Hoogzand residential project, specifically designed for comfortable, lifelong living. Located at Hoogeind 345 in the village of Molenschot, the complex consists of 24 high-quality rental apartments situated within the new De Nieuwe Erven neighborhood. The building features contemporary architecture with clean lines, a playful roofline, and large windows, giving it a robust and modern appearance. The apartment is situated on one floor, making it easily accessible for residents of all mobility levels.

Inside, the apartment offers a living area of approximately 59 m² and includes a bright living room, a modern kitchen, and one bedroom. The bathroom is equipped with a shower, toilet, and washbasin. For added comfort, the entire apartment features underfloor heating powered by a heat pump, and hot water is supplied through an electric boiler. The energy efficiency is excellent, with an A+++ energy label achieved through HR glass and full insulation. Mechanical and balanced ventilation systems are installed to ensure a healthy indoor climate.

The apartment includes a private indoor storage space of 6 m², while the building itself offers a communal garden and a shared living room for residents. A lift provides easy access to all floors, and wide doorways throughout the apartment enhance accessibility. Care services are also available on request. Depending on the unit, residents can enjoy a comfortable balcony or terrace.

The location combines the tranquility of rural living with convenient access to urban amenities. The complex is set in a green, wooded area within a quiet residential neighborhood, with the charming village center of Molenschot within easy reach. Public transport connections are available nearby, and major roads provide quick access to cities such as Breda and Tilburg. Parking is available on a secured site within the grounds of the complex.
